Those were the days ... !!

If there ever was a picture that spoke a thousand words (maybe a million ... maybe more), its probably this ...



Yeah those were the days ...
When the towel acted as a photo background ...
When you thought of everything other than money (and related entities) ...
When 50 paise sufficed for a day's journey from home to school and back ...
When I avoided going back home by bus so that I can save 25 paise to ... wait ... not to own a house ... but to see myself gorging on the Raspberry ice cream that was for Rs. 3
When wearing a white school uniform should have acted a reminder to keep it clean ... but instead it was the exact opposite ... a white uniform meant that it had to be DIRTIED ...
When innocence won over almost everything ...
When the scolding received from parents resulted in making a mental note of things ...
When Akku-Takku, Lappa-Chhupi and Langdi were the HEP games ...
When haircuts were done on a SHEVGE-CHA-ZHAAD (drumstick tree)
When summer meant climbing up the Jamun tree and getting Jamuns for the entire Basti ...
When we made a beeline at the place of The PATILS to catch a glimpse of Chitrahaar and Mickey-Donald or the weekend movies ...
When Zatra (Mela) was the event of the year ...
When the place to shit was a place where the most luxurious township of the area stands today ...
When Ganpati meant watching 4 movies from 6 pm to 6 am behind the Mandal ... the movies being ... Gair Kanooni, Bhrashtachaar, Mitti aur Sona and Lashkar ... its a bloody tough challenge to locate these movies ...
When I didnt have to think twice (probably more now) to wrestle a girl over a petty reason ...
When my sister won 2 cans of Complan full of marbles defeating all the guys in the Basti ...

But the most important of all ... you wanted to get done with school as soon as possible and thought that life after school would be rosy ... well ... almost ... sigh ... Yeah ... those were the days ... Cheers ... !!
